Thanks Dan!! :) I could successfully build EXchess under MacOSX by adding an include statement for unistd.h at line 18. Build line was: c++ -o EXchess exchess.cc -O2 -pipe EXchess couldn't use the opening book I gave it (main_bk.dat). I assume the reason is big/little endianess. I will try to build an opening book out of a .pgn file later though. (any suggestions what pgn to use - I don't need a 7gb opening book, just a lil/medium one would do :) Also it seems that main_bk.dat is twice in the zip file. At least unzip asked me to rename the 2nd one and the "diff file1 file2" didn't find any differences. Sargon
